Jammu, April 2 --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Omar Abdullah on Thursday asserted that the 1979 agreement between the Governments of Jammu and Kashmir and Punjab was a sovereign commitment that must be honoured in letter and spirit.

The Chief Minister made these remarks on the floor of the House while replying to a supplementary question raised by MLA Basohli Darshan Kumar regarding compensation, employment for locals, and J&K's 20 per cent share of electricity from the Ranjit Sagar Dam project.
